Fortress is a 2021 American action film directed by James Cullen Bressack and written by Alan Horsnail, based on a story by Emile Hirsch and Randall Emmett. It stars Jesse Metcalfe, Bruce Willis, Chad Michael Murray, Kelly Greyson, Ser'Darius Blain, and Shannen Doherty. The film was released in select theaters and on video on demand by Lionsgate Films on December 17, 2021.

Plot


Robert and his son Paul live in a top-secret resort for retired U.S. intelligence officers. Balzary and his group of criminals infiltrate the resort and force Robert and Paul into a high-tech bunker.

Production


Filming began on May 3, 2021, in Puerto Rico. The film was announced that same day as the first part in a duology of films starring Jesse Metcalfe, Bruce Willis, Chad Michael Murray, and Kelly Greyson. The second film, titled Fortress: Sniper's Eye, was shot back-to-back with the first;[2] production on the second film concluded on November 3, 2021.[3][4] On May 15, 2021, director James Cullen Bressack said filming on the first film had wrapped.[5]

Box office


As of August 27, 2022, Fortress grossed $52,169 in the United Arab Emirates and Portugal.[1]


Critical reception


On the review aggregator website Rotten Tomatoes, 20% of 5 critics' reviews are positive, with an average rating of 4.9/10.[8] At the 42nd Golden Raspberry Awards, the film received a nomination in a new category: Worst Performance by Bruce Willis in a 2021 Movie.[9] The category was later rescinded after Willis' retirement due to aphasia.[10]
